Essential Functions
A trustworthy business phone system must include call redirection capabilities, permitting calls to be forwarded to multiple extensions or outside lines as needed. This feature ensures that significant calls are not missed, even when employees are away from their offices. It boosts flexibility and responsiveness, key components of a successful business communication strategy.
Another important feature is voicemail-to-inbox integration. This allows messages left in a business phone's voicemail to be sent directly to an employee's email inbox. This functionality not only streamlines communication but also permits employees to get voicemail messages more conveniently, facilitating prompt responses and action on important matters.
Lastly, a straightforward interface is essential for any business telephone system. A straightforward and user-friendly interface makes it easier for staff to handle features and settings, reducing the learning curve associated with updated systems. This ease of use helps employees to focus on their tasks rather than struggling with complex technology, ultimately improving overall productivity.
Improved Functionality
In today's challenging business landscape, a reliable business phone system should feature cutting-edge functionality that enhances productivity and interaction. Features such as forwarding calls, voicemail-to-email, and automatic call distribution are vital for making sure that calls are processed effectively. With call forwarding, employees can receive calls on their mobile devices when they are out of their desks, allowing them to remain in touch with clients and colleagues. The voicemail to email feature turns voicemail messages into email alerts, facilitating quicker responses and better message management.
Another critical feature is the integration of CRM software with the business telephone system. This enables for seamless communication between sales and service teams, providing them with important customer information during calls. Lastly, sophisticated data analysis and reporting features are crucial for any business phone system. Being able to monitor call metrics, such as the volume of calls, duration, and response times, gives businesses with insights into their communication effectiveness. This data enables managers to recognize trends, optimize workforce allocation, and enhance overall customer experience. By utilizing these advanced functionalities, businesses can greatly improve their operations and keep a competitive edge.
Integration Features
Integration capabilities are a crucial feature of any effective business phone system. A telephone system that seamlessly connects with other applications can significantly boost productivity and communal efficiency. Whether it's integrating with customer relationship management tools, email services, or project management software, the ability to establish a unified communication environment enables employees to work more efficiently and together.
When choosing a business telephone system, think about how well it integrates with existing technologies. This entails the ability to work with hardware such as headsets and conference phones, as well as software platforms that your team relies on. A system that offers solid integration options can streamline workflows, reduce the need for flipping between applications, and ultimately enhance the general user interaction.
Moreover, advanced integration capabilities can offer features such as logging calls, automated follow-ups, and enhanced reporting. These tools not only promote better communication but also provide valuable insights into customer engagements and team performance. By putting resources in a business phone system that prioritizes integration, companies can ensure they are well-equipped to meet the demands of a fast-paced work environment.
